What are the downsides of purchasing a foreclosed house?

Obtaining a price cut on a property is awesome, but unfortunately there are dangers involved with this. Financial institutions sell such houses with no legal warranty.

Quite simply, you cannot file a claim against them or get any kind of financial redress when there’s a problem with the building or an unforeseen vice. It is sold “as is”.

Due to this, getting a mortgage to finance your property may be much harder because lenders are generally a little more careful.

On top of that, with regards to the prior owners who stopped paying their mortgage repayments, occasionally such people allowed their house to fall into dilapidation, vandalized it or sometimes even used the premises to cultivate marijuana which may cause fungus.

Checking out the property just before making an offer is certainly encouraged, although at times it’s difficult to pay a visit to the vendors and can require a down payment or even a blind offer.

It isn’t often like this, although these are factors worth considering prior to making any move.

Distress Real Estate Sales & Determined Vendors

Distressed property sales or forced vendors may be even better than a foreclosure. These houses may be a pre-repossession or just a vendor that needs to sell up quickly for many different reasons.

Pre-repossessions / 60-day property repossession directive

In the example of a pre-repossession, the owner has to get rid of it very fast in order to save his equity before the mortgage lender repossesses the estate. In general, the mortgage lender has given them a 60-day instruction.

Bogged down with two mortgages

An additional explanation for any owner becoming forced to sell at a lower price may be simply because they’ve just purchased another home ahead of trying to sell the present home and so do not want to become trapped with two home loans.

Buying another home on condition of selling their existing home

It can also be that the owner has made an offer regarding another purchase with an offer conditional to sell his existing one. This may be their dream home or they’re just attached to this contract and thus willing to take a haircut on your offer.

Inheritance house sales or estate administration

Inheritance house sales are often fantastic finds too given that the brand new owner who has only just inherited their house is prepared to sell the property below the market valuation for a number of reasons.

Most often, they simply want to get the cash as quickly as possible. Also, if there are multiple recipients of the inheritance, selling off the home makes it much simpler to split this equity.

Fixer-Upper Properties

Houses which would need refurbishment are often yet another superb opportunity. These types of houses are generally priced under market price since they require some care and attention.

It is possible to make a good profit after all costs if you’ve got an extra allowance for fixing up the property and you can do the majority of the refurbishments yourself.

You also will be able to individualize it to your individual taste and needs if your objective is to live in the property.

If it’s for a flip, you could always carry out strategical makeovers to maximize resale value and market appeal.

Like in any other real estate purchase, having the property examined is extremely important in ensuring that there’s no significant repair needed which could turn your real estate bargain into a profitless one.
